Mengulas roadmap belajar pemrograman 2025 berdasarkan kebutuhan perusahaan, tren teknologi global, dan prioritas perekrutan, dengan fokus pada kebangkitan “R” dalam analisis data modern.
Tahun 2025 hadir dengan dinamika besar dalam dunia teknologi. Perusahaan terus melakukan ekspansi digital, mengadopsi AI, memperkuat keamanan cyber, dan memindahkan sistem ke cloud. Hal ini membuat kebutuhan programmer meningkat, namun di saat yang sama standar juga semakin tinggi.
Bukan lagi sekadar “bisa coding”, tetapi harus menguasai bahasa dan framework yang benar-benar digunakan di dunia kerja.
Di tengah persaingan itu, menariknya, “R” kembali menjadi primadona bukan hanya di kampus, tetapi di perusahaan besar yang membutuhkan analisis data tingkat lanjut.
Artikel ini adalah roadmap lengkap untuk mengetahui skill apa saja yang harus kamu kuasai agar tetap relevan, kompetitif, dan dicari perusahaan di 2025.
Perubahan Besar Dunia Kerja Teknologi di 2025
Transformasi digital 5 tahun terakhir membuat perusahaan mau tidak mau harus berinvestasi pada teknologi modern. Ada tiga perubahan besar:
1. Ledakan AI & Machine Learning
Semua sektor from retail sampai kesehatan menggunakan AI untuk operasional dan prediksi
2. Pertumbuhan Infrastruktur Cloud
Banyak sistem lama (legacy system) diganti dengan platform berbasis cloud yang scalable.
3. Ledakan Data Tak Terbendung
Volume data meningkat tajam, dan perusahaan perlu tenaga ahli yang bisa mengolahnya menjadi insight.
Perubahan ini melahirkan kebutuhan baru terhadap bahasa pemrograman tertentu, terutama yang mendukung data, cloud, dan AI.
Bahasa Pemrograman Terpenting di 2025
1. R — Bahasa Statistik yang Kembali Naik Daun
Untuk beberapa tahun terakhir, “R” dianggap kalem dibanding Python. Namun 2025 membuktikan bahwa R kembali berkuasa, terutama di:
- sektor riset
- perusahaan fintech
- perbankan
- analisis risiko
- kesehatan dan farmasi
- lembaga penelitian
Kenapa R kembali diminati?
- Kemampuan statistik yang lebih presisi dibanding Python.
- Paket analisis dan visualisasi yang jauh lebih lengkap (ggplot2, dplyr, tidyverse).
- Cocok untuk model prediktif rumit dan data yang membutuhkan validasi statistik ketat.
- Integrasi yang semakin baik dengan cloud (AWS, GCP).
- Banyak digunakan untuk quantitative finance & risk modeling, di mana akurasi sangat krusial.
Perusahaan mencari programmer yang:
- menguasai R + SQL
- memahami data cleansing & modeling
- mampu membuat visualisasi yang presisi
- bisa kolaborasi dengan analyst & scientist
“R bukan sekadar bahasa, tapi alat utama untuk keputusan berbasis data.”
2. Python Raja Universal & Mesin AI
Python tetap menjadi bahasa paling populer dan paling serbaguna.
Kenapa perusahaan masih memilih Python?
- Perpustakaan AI/ML terlengkap (TensorFlow, PyTorch).
- Mudah dipelajari pemula, namun kuat untuk aplikasi enterprise.
- Banyak digunakan di otomasi, backend, dan scripting.
Python tetap menjadi bahasa wajib bagi siapa pun yang ingin masuk dunia data atau AI.
3. Go (Golang) – Standar Baru untuk Cloud & DevOps
Perusahaan cloud dan startup memilih Go karena:
- cepat, ringan, dan mudah diparalel-kan
- dipakai Google, Uber, Dropbox, Kubernetes
- sangat ideal untuk microservices dan sistem backend berskala besar
Go akan menjadi skill yang paling dicari di bidang cloud-native development.
4. TypeScript – Masa Depan Web Development
Jika kamu ingin masuk dunia web modern, TypeScript wajib dikuasai karena:
- menawarkan keamanan tipe
- memudahkan pembangunan aplikasi besar
- menjadi pondasi framework modern
Framework yang paling naik daun di 2025:
- Next.js
- SvelteKit
- Remix
Framework Terpopuler & Diburu Perusahaan 2025
1. Next.js Raja Frontend Modern
Perusahaan menyukai Next.js karena:
- rendering cepat
- SEO-friendly
- cocok untuk aplikasi skala besar
Dengan tren e-commerce, sistem edukasi, SaaS, dan dashboard, Next.js menjadi kerangka kerja wajib untuk web programmer.
2. TensorFlow & PyTorch Mesin AI Masa Depan
AI bukan sekadar tren ia menjadi tulang punggung bisnis.
Framework ini digunakan untuk:
- chatbots
- rekomendasi produk
- model prediktif
- data mining
- deep learning
Programmer AI yang menguasai salah satu akan sangat dicari.
3. Spring Boot – Solusi Backend Enterprise
Walau banyak bahasa baru, Java tetap kuat di perusahaan besar. Ribuan aplikasi banking, pemerintahan, dan enterprise menggunakan Spring Boot.
Kelebihan:
- stabil
- scalable
- community besar
- banyak kebutuhan di perusahaan besar
4. Kubernetes & Docker Wajib untuk Cloud Engineer
Tanpa dua ini, sulit berkembang di dunia cloud.
Perusahaan mencari engineer yang paham:
- kontainerisasi
- deployment otomatis
- load balancing
- scaling sistem
Kubernetes menjadi standar global.
Roadmap Belajar 2025—Dari Nol sampai Diterima Kerja
Jika kamu ingin menjadi programmer unggul, berikut roadmap yang paling relevan:
1. Tentukan Jalur Karier Utama
- Data & AI → R + Python + TensorFlow/PyTorch
- Web Development → TypeScript + Next.js
- Cloud Engineer → Go + Kubernetes
- Backend Developer → Java + Spring Boot
2. Kuasai Fundamental
- Struktur data
- OOP
- Database
- API dan networking
3. Bangun Portofolio Kuat
Perusahaan tidak menilai ijazah sebanyak hasil yang bisa dilihat.
4. Siapkan Sertifikasi yang Relevan
Beberapa sertifikasi yang diperhitungkan:
- Google Data Analytics
- AWS Cloud Practitioner
- TensorFlow Developer Certificate
- Microsoft AI Engineer
Kesimpulan
Tahun 2025 akan menjadi tahun penting bagi programmer. Dunia teknologi membutuhkan talenta yang tidak hanya bisa ngoding, tetapi menguasai bahasa dan framework yang relevan dengan kebutuhan nyata perusahaan.
Dan dalam peta itu, “R” muncul sebagai kejutan besar. Bahasa yang dulu dianggap akademis kini menjadi fondasi penting untuk perusahaan yang ingin menghasilkan keputusan cerdas berbasis data.
Dengan memahami roadmap ini, kamu tidak hanya mengikuti tren kamu memimpin di depan.
Untuk informasi lebih lanjut dan sumber belajar, kunjungi Fedu.co.id atau hubungi +62 852-1525-3460.
